ROB Camra left this review about William & Victoria

Pretty much a restaurant these days. There's a small bar area where 3 locals were having a drink, the rest was taken up by dining tables. Upstairs there's another restaurant area. Flag floors , low ceilings and lots of nooks and crannies make it quite atmospheric, but it's not really a pub. I had a pint of fizz and MS CAMRA had a very nice glass of red wine. We'd eat here, but not call in for a drink again.

Old Boots left this review about William & Victoria Wine Bar

Looking like an art gallery or antiques shop from the outside, the upper floors are a restaurant and the basement houses a wine bar/brasserie. Guinness, John Smith Smooth and 1664 kegs plus a limited number of bottled beers from the likes of Becks and Peroni are available but naturally there is a wide choice of fine wines by the glass or bottle. Simple decoration of flag floor and plain walls, there is a vast array of blackboards listing the wines available complimented with a number of tasteful prints and maps. Casual drinkers are not unwelcome but there are limited facilities for them in the cramped dining focused space. A pleasant and elegant place to eat and drink but not in any way a pub.
